Electric-power conversion apparatus

There is provided an electric-power conversion apparatus in which smoke emission, a burnout, and short-circuiting can be suppressed even when a fuse portion is melted by an excessive current and in which it is made possible that heat generated in the fuse portion is less likely to be transferred to the electric power semiconductor device. The electric-power conversion apparatus includes a fuse portion formed in an electrode wiring member, a fuse resin member that covers the fuse portion, and a sealing resin member that seals an electric power semiconductor device and the fuse portion in a case. Along a current-flowing direction, the fuse portion includes an upstream-side first step portion whose cross-sectional area is smaller than that of the portion at the upstream side thereof, a second step portion whose cross-sectional area is smaller than that of the upstream-side first step portion, and a downstream-side first step portion whose cross-sectional area is larger than that of the second step portion but is smaller than that of the portion at the downstream side thereof.

Fuse

A fuse includes a fuse element extending along an axis, the fuse element including two terminals and a melt portion arranged between the two terminals, a casing that accommodates the melt portion and an arc-extinguishing material, the casing including an outer circumferential surface and two end surfaces, the casing being an assembly of at least two segments, and a molded body made of plastic, the molded body including two covers that respectively cover the two end surfaces and including one or more coupling portions that couple the two covers to each other, the two covers and the one or more coupling portions being integrally molded. The casing includes one or more exposed portions on the outer circumferential surface, the one or more exposed portions being exposed without being covered by the coupling portions.

Electronic device with built in fuse

An electronic device that includes an intermediate connection layer interposed between a wiring substrate with a pair of land electrodes and an electronic component. The intermediate connection layer has first and second connection electrodes formed on the surface of a base. A fuse part is formed inside the second connection electrode between a main conductor part thereof opposed to a first external electrode of the electronic component and a main conductor part of the first connection electrode opposed to a second external electrode of the electronic component.

High voltage power fuse including fatigue resistant fuse element and methods of making the same

A power fuse includes a housing, first and second conductive terminals extending from the housing, and at least one fatigue resistant fuse element assembly connected between the first and second terminals. The fuse element assembly includes at least a first conductive plate and a second conductive plate respectively connecting the first and second conductive terminals, and a plurality of separately provided wire bonded weak spots interconnecting the first conductive plate and the second conductive plate.

SAFETY DEVICE AND BATTERY USING THE SAME

A safety device comprises a first heat dissipation part, a second heat dissipation part and a connecting part. The connecting part is arranged between the first heat dissipation part and the second heat dissipation part, and at least one heat locking hole disposed thereon. The heat locking hole of the connecting part can reduce a diffusion speed of heat of the connecting part, so that the heat is concentrated between the first heat locking hole and the second heat locking hole, and thus the connecting part can be fused in time at a high temperature.

FUSE ELEMENT ASSEMBLY AND METHOD OF FABRICATING THE SAME

A fuse element assembly has been disclosed. The fuse element assembly includes a fuse element having a pair of side edges and at least one weak spot between the side edges. The fuse element assembly also includes an arc-quenching material attached locally to the fuse element adjacent the weak spot.
